Code:
/ DotNET / DotNET / 8.0 / untmp / whidbey / REDBITS / ndp / clr / src / BCL / System / Runtime / Remoting / RemotingException.cs / 1 / RemotingException.cs
// ==++== // // Copyright (c) Microsoft Corporation. All rights reserved. // // ==--== /*============================================================================== ** ** Class: RemotingException ** ** ** Purpose: Exception class for remoting ** ** =============================================================================*/ namespace System.Runtime.Remoting { using System.Runtime.Remoting; using System; using System.Runtime.Serialization; // The Exception thrown when something has gone // wrong during remoting // [Serializable()] [System.Runtime.InteropServices.ComVisible(true)] public class RemotingException : SystemException { private static String _nullMessage = Environment.GetResourceString("Remoting_Default"); // Creates a new RemotingException with its message // string set to a default message. public RemotingException() : base(_nullMessage) { SetErrorCode(__HResults.COR_E_REMOTING); } public RemotingException(String message) : base(message) { SetErrorCode(__HResults.COR_E_REMOTING); } public RemotingException(String message, Exception InnerException) : base(message, InnerException) { SetErrorCode(__HResults.COR_E_REMOTING); } protected RemotingException(SerializationInfo info, StreamingContext context) : base(info, context) {} } // The Exception thrown when something has gone // wrong on the server during remoting. This exception is thrown // on the client. // [Serializable()] [System.Runtime.InteropServices.ComVisible(true)] public class ServerException : SystemException { private static String _nullMessage = Environment.GetResourceString("Remoting_Default"); // Creates a new ServerException with its message // string set to a default message. public ServerException() : base(_nullMessage) { SetErrorCode(__HResults.COR_E_SERVER); } public ServerException(String message) : base(message) { SetErrorCode(__HResults.COR_E_SERVER); } public ServerException(String message, Exception InnerException) : base(message, InnerException) { SetErrorCode(__HResults.COR_E_SERVER); } internal ServerException(SerializationInfo info, StreamingContext context) : base(info, context) {} } [Serializable()] [System.Runtime.InteropServices.ComVisible(true)] public class RemotingTimeoutException : RemotingException { private static String _nullMessage = Environment.GetResourceString("Remoting_Default"); // Creates a new RemotingException with its message // string set to a default message. public RemotingTimeoutException() : base(_nullMessage) { } public RemotingTimeoutException(String message) : base(message) { SetErrorCode(__HResults.COR_E_REMOTING); } public RemotingTimeoutException(String message, Exception InnerException) : base(message, InnerException) { SetErrorCode(__HResults.COR_E_REMOTING); } internal RemotingTimeoutException(SerializationInfo info, StreamingContext context) : base(info, context) {} } // RemotingTimeoutException }
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- BindingMAnagerBase.cs
- NonParentingControl.cs
- XmlnsCache.cs
- HiddenField.cs
- Quaternion.cs
- ParallelTimeline.cs
- SrgsDocumentParser.cs
- WebServiceParameterData.cs
- DynamicField.cs
- CurrentChangingEventManager.cs
- GlyphRun.cs
- ProjectionPruner.cs
- SQLDecimal.cs
- SafeBitVector32.cs
- ClientType.cs
- XsdDateTime.cs
- DynamicDataRouteHandler.cs
- BindingBase.cs
- DetailsViewUpdatedEventArgs.cs
- CommandEventArgs.cs
- ItemTypeToolStripMenuItem.cs
- EventLogInternal.cs
- ObjectAssociationEndMapping.cs
- OdbcCommandBuilder.cs
- StoreContentChangedEventArgs.cs
- XmlCharType.cs
- httpstaticobjectscollection.cs
- OleDbException.cs
- UserControlCodeDomTreeGenerator.cs
- DtrList.cs
- IMembershipProvider.cs
- Style.cs
- ClonableStack.cs
- EntityCommandCompilationException.cs
- DynamicRenderer.cs
- InvalidOleVariantTypeException.cs
- NameValueCollection.cs
- DataFormats.cs
- TreeChangeInfo.cs
- DesignerGeometryHelper.cs
- DeferredElementTreeState.cs
- SQLConvert.cs
- FormViewInsertEventArgs.cs
- EntityViewContainer.cs
- Pair.cs
- CompilationRelaxations.cs
- WindowsListViewScroll.cs
- WindowsListViewItem.cs
- LinqDataSourceDisposeEventArgs.cs
- SqlSelectStatement.cs
- XmlComplianceUtil.cs
- DateTimeConverter2.cs
- TextBox.cs
- AutoGeneratedFieldProperties.cs
- CachedFontFace.cs
- XmlSchemaSet.cs
- EventSourceCreationData.cs
- Expander.cs
- StringReader.cs
- UntrustedRecipientException.cs
- DataRecord.cs
- ConnectionManagementSection.cs
- HwndSourceKeyboardInputSite.cs
- FileLogRecord.cs
- TypeValidationEventArgs.cs
- DataGrid.cs
- BamlBinaryReader.cs
- ChooseAction.cs
- Compiler.cs
- IPPacketInformation.cs
- SerializableTypeCodeDomSerializer.cs
- HttpRequestCacheValidator.cs
- AccessDataSource.cs
- XmlElementAttribute.cs
- Polygon.cs
- AdobeCFFWrapper.cs
- UInt16.cs
- JsonByteArrayDataContract.cs
- ExpressionBinding.cs
- CatalogPart.cs
- ReferencedType.cs
- SystemWebCachingSectionGroup.cs
- ViewBox.cs
- Base64Encoder.cs
- TableLayoutSettings.cs
- QueryRewriter.cs
- WsdlBuildProvider.cs
- Encoder.cs
- ValidateNames.cs
- FrameworkElementFactory.cs
- DataBindingHandlerAttribute.cs
- TdsRecordBufferSetter.cs
- GlobalProxySelection.cs
- ToolStripSplitStackLayout.cs
- DockAndAnchorLayout.cs
- WmlLiteralTextAdapter.cs
- _CommandStream.cs
- InterleavedZipPartStream.cs
- designeractionlistschangedeventargs.cs
- DetailsViewDeleteEventArgs.cs